Victor Wembanyama's Unique Training with Shaolin Monks in China
[HPP] Victor WembanyamaAugust 26, 20254 min
3 connectionsΒ·4 entities in this videoβUnique Offseason Training
- π‘ Victor Wembanyama described his summer as a non-traditional offseason, traveling the world and engaging in unique training.
- π― He spent two weeks in China, specifically practicing with Shaolin monks at a temple.
Shaolin Temple Experience
- π The primary goal was to put his body through different things it wasn't used to, aiming to widen his range of movement and strength.
- π₯ His daily routine included kung fu practice at a vegan monastery, which was a stark contrast to his usual training.
Physical and Dietary Challenges
- π₯ The temple's vegan diet presented a challenge, with breakfast at 5 AM consisting of bold zucchinis and rice noodles.
- β οΈ Wembanyama had to eat outside the temple to ensure he didn't lose weight, highlighting the strict dietary regimen.
Cultural Immersion and Transformation
- βοΈ As part of the experience, he and others had to shave their heads, a tradition associated with the monks.
- π§ He mentioned feeling like he became "Buddhist" after participating in rituals and saying things in Chinese, despite not understanding them.
Overall Impact
- β¨ Wembanyama considered the entire experience a "great experience" and "definitely worth it" for the personal and physical development it offered.
